Where does “crucioc” come from?
crucioc (Romanian) comes from Russian крючо́к, from Russian крюк, from Old Norse krókr, from Proto-Germanic krōkaz, from Proto-Indo-European gerg-, from Proto-Indo-European ger- — to turn, bend, twist, wind; to tie, bind...
crucioc (Romanian): pantry latch
